I haven't read the whole update yet but when you say the expectations for solving the puzzles are high, do you mean the puzzles are cognitively demanding or that they are put together by cathair-mustache crazy adventure game designers?

Because those are two very different flavors of "hard."
Don't worry, it's the former. Back when this game came out (and I do remember the five CDs) I wasn't willing to put in the commitment necessary to solve it on my own, but having used a guide to beat it I can appreciate the...er...purity of the puzzles. All of them can, as with Myst, be solved with sufficient consideration of the puzzle itself and the surrounding environment. Unlike most adventure games your inventory is extremely limited, and when you do have to use something from it you'll know.
